Types of house crane

There are several different types of cranes that can be used for house construction and renovation. Each type has its own unique features and benefits, and the choice of crane depends on the specific requirements of the project. Here are some common types of house cranes:

1. Mobile Crane: This type of crane is mounted on a wheeled vehicle, allowing it to be easily moved around the construction site. Mobile cranes are versatile and can be used for a variety of tasks, such as lifting and placing heavy materials, equipment, or even entire pre-fabricated sections of a house.

2. Tower Crane: Tower cranes are commonly used for high-rise construction projects. They are tall, fixed cranes that are erected on site and can reach great heights. Tower cranes have a horizontal jib with a lifting capacity of several tons, making them ideal for lifting construction materials to higher levels.

3. Crawler Crane: This type of crane is mounted on a set of tracks or crawlers, allowing it to move across rough terrain or on uneven ground. Crawler cranes are commonly used in house construction sites with limited access or in areas where the ground may be unstable. They have excellent stability and lifting capacity, making them suitable for heavy lifting tasks.

4. Rough Terrain Crane: As the name suggests, rough terrain cranes are designed to operate in off-road conditions. They have specially designed tires and outriggers for stability on rough or uneven terrain. These cranes are commonly used in rural or remote areas where the construction site may not have well-paved access roads.

5. Mini Crane: Mini cranes, also known as compact cranes, are relatively small in size and are ideal for tight spaces or indoor house construction projects. They have a compact footprint and can be easily maneuvered into confined areas. Mini cranes are often used for tasks like installing windows, lifting equipment, or handling materials in narrow spaces.

Crane selection depends on factors such as the height and weight of the loads to be lifted, the required reach, the site conditions, and other specific project needs. It is essential to consult with a qualified engineer or crane specialist to determine the most suitable type of crane for a house construction project.

The Work Process and how to use house crane

The work process for using a house crane involves several steps that ensure safe and efficient operation. Here is a brief overview:

1. Planning: Before using a house crane, it is essential to plan the lift thoroughly. Consider factors such as the weight and dimensions of the load, the distance it needs to be lifted, and any obstacles or hazards that may be present. Obtain the necessary permits or permissions for the lift if required.

2. Inspection: Conduct a pre-use inspection of the house crane to ensure it is in proper working condition. Check the stability of the base, inspect the cables and hooks for any signs of damage, and review the controls and safety devices.

3. Set up: Position the house crane on stable ground, ensuring it is level and secure. Extend the outriggers to maximize stability and lower the boom to a suitable height for the lift. Use the load chart provided by the manufacturer to determine the crane’s lifting capacity at different boom lengths and angles.

4. Rigging: Properly rig the load using appropriate slings or lifting devices. Ensure that the load is balanced and securely attached to the crane’s hook. Consider using tag lines if necessary to control the load during the lift.

5. Communication: Establish clear communication signals between the operator and the signalperson on the ground. Use standardized signals and ensure both parties understand each other’s cues.

6. Lifting: With the load properly rigged and all safety measures in place, the operator can initiate the lift. Use smooth and controlled movements to raise the load, avoiding sudden stops or jerks. Constantly monitor the crane’s stability and adjust the boom’s angle as needed.

7. Placement: Once the load is in the desired position, the operator should lower it carefully. Ensure the load is placed securely and verify that it is stable before releasing it from the crane’s hook.

8. Post-use inspection: After completing the lift, conduct a post-use inspection of the crane to identify any wear or damage. Report any issues to the appropriate personnel for maintenance or repair.

Remember that these steps provide only a general overview, and it is crucial to consult the specific operation and safety manuals provided by the crane manufacturer. Additionally, operators must receive proper training and certification to ensure they have the necessary skills and knowledge to use a house crane safely.

Shipping Cost for house crane import from China

The shipping cost for importing a house crane from China can vary depending on several factors such as the size and weight of the crane, the shipping method chosen, and the destination. Generally, there are two main shipping methods: air freight and sea freight.

Air freight is the faster option but tends to be more expensive. The cost is usually calculated based on the weight and size of the crane. Moreover, additional charges may apply for customs clearance, documentation, and insurance. It is important to note that air shipping is more suitable for smaller cranes due to weight and size restrictions.

On the other hand, sea freight is a cost-effective option for larger and heavier cranes. The cost is primarily determined by the volume and weight of the cargo. Additional charges, including customs duties, port handling fees, and customs clearance, may also apply. It is worth noting that the transit time for sea freight is longer compared to air freight.

To provide a specific shipping cost, more details are required such as the origin and destination ports, the dimensions and weight of the crane, and specific shipping requirements. Furthermore, factors like customs charges and duties can vary depending on the importing country’s regulations. It is advisable to consult with shipping companies or freight forwarders to obtain accurate quotes and information tailored to individual shipping needs.

In conclusion, the shipping cost for importing a house crane from China can range significantly due to various factors. It is recommended to conduct thorough research, gather all necessary details, and consult with experienced shipping professionals to ensure a smooth and cost-effective shipment.
